Welcome to PART THREE of this 3-part series event: SELF-DEFENSE AND CAMPUS READINESS FOR STUDENTS Join US Sunday, March 29th for an intimate evening with Mala Muñoz leads a conversation-based self-DEFENSE CLASS. This self-DEFENSE CLASS IS A focused class that explores rape culture and violence against women on college campuses. This class includes a discussion of Title IX, campus reporting options, and introductory physical self-defense basics for college students.  Mala is a podcaster, writer, and co-founder of Locatora Radio. She has a professional background as a sex educator, self-defense instructor, and state-certified rape crisis counselor-advocate. Her self-defense workshops are informed by her experience working as an advocate on the Emergency Response Team at Peace Over Violence. She has written about Latinx media representation and rape culture in the Latinx community for VIBE & Everyday Feminism. Limited seats available: maximum capacity 16.
